About the role
The Registered Nurse coordinates and delivers high quality, patient-centered care in accordance with the nature and specific requirements of the department, and consistent with the scope and standards of practice for the relevant state and specialty.
Responsibilities
- Collaborates with medical providers and other members of the care team to provide individualized, comprehensive, and compassionate care using established nursing models such as “Assess, Perform, Teach, and Manage.”
- Serves as an advocate for patients/families/caregivers and models a commitment to the organization’s vision/mission/values to support an unparalleled patient experience and clinical outcomes that contribute to overall departmental performance.
- Affirms patient pain regularly to promote effective pain management, including reassessments after appropriate intervention.
- Performs procedures, monitoring, or other functions as ordered by the medical provider(s).
- Documents the administration of care in the patient medical record in a timely and thorough manner.
- Responds promptly to patient requests.
- Anticipates patient needs and resolves them proactively.
- Teaches patients/families/caregivers about patient medical condition, patient status, treatment plan, medications and possible side effects, and follow-up measures.
- Translates complex medical terminology to ensure complete understanding.
- Teaches patients/families/caregivers about any non-medicinal follow-up measures, such as healthy diet and exercise, disease prevention, and/or other lifestyle changes.
- Prepares patients and families/caregivers for future self-management.

- Medical City Heart & Spine Hospitals are hospitals for specialized advanced cardiovascular and spine care.
- The facilities are located near Medical City Dallas.
- They are designed to be efficient and result in faster recoveries.
- We offer an enhanced patient experience.
- Patients will benefit from leading edge treatments and technology.
- We offer clinical trials.
- You will have access to the entire network of Medical City Healthcare hospitals and specialists.
- Medical City Heart Hospital has 65+ private patient rooms.
- The facility provides a wide array of cardiac services.
- Services include complex vascular and heart surgery and advanced heart failure treatment.
- We offer minimally invasive vascular surgery and other specialized heart care.
- The facility has a dedicated cardiac emergency room.
- Medical City Spine Hospital has 25+ beds.
- It provides spine care for common spine disorders.
- Spine care is also provided for rare, hard-to-treat spinal deformities.
- Those include adult and pediatric scoliosis and spondylolistheses.
- We offer complex spine surgery and minimally invasive surgical options.
